ST. JOHN AMBULANCE

CADET COMPETITIONS HIGH STANDARD OF WORK The annual efficiency competitions to St. John Ambulance cadets were heu at the ambulance headquarters, R ut * land Street, on Saturday afternoon, '2l teams competing. Mr. C. J. Tunk»the district commissioner, thanked tW doctors who acted as judges. The wor" of the cadets was of a high standar in the opinion of the adjudicators.
